Output 3daa439a1bb73af8d5d36731a292a6cbf41a31c9daba29e32d0c79df63d05a66:0

value
259315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23a7bfc4e127880ff7f0857587f4b0d2fac0ebf0 OP_EQUAL
address
34wYXfnMukF7qJHfzUWt9n7C1i5dx57cFS
transaction
3daa439a1bb73af8d5d36731a292a6cbf41a31c9daba29e32d0c79df63d05a66
spent
true